Selenium compounds interact differently with cadmium ions (Cd2+). Selenite and selenourea form complexes, while selenate and selenomethionine show minimal interaction, impacting cadmium toxicity understanding.

Area of Science:

  • Environmental Chemistry
  • Toxicology
  • Analytical Chemistry

Background:

  • Cadmium (Cd2+) ions are toxic environmental pollutants.
  • Selenium compounds are essential micronutrients with varying chemical behaviors.
  • Understanding metal-ion interactions is crucial for toxicology and environmental science.

Purpose of the Study:

  • To investigate the interaction between cadmium ions (Cd2+) and various selenium compounds.
  • To elucidate the influence of selenium's oxidation state on Cd2+ complexation.
  • To provide insights into cadmium toxicity mechanisms and selenium's role in metal ion distribution.

Main Methods:

  • Polarography was employed to study the interactions.
  • Changes in polarographic currents and half-wave potentials of Cd2+ were monitored.

  • The effect of different selenium derivative concentrations on Cd2+ behavior was analyzed.
  • Main Results:

    • Selenate showed no interaction with Cd2+ ions.
    • Selenite formed detectable complexes with Cd2+ in solution.
    • Selenourea formed complexes with Cd2+, evidenced by potential shifts and solubility limitations.
    • Selenomethionine exhibited very weak interaction with Cd2+ ions.

    Conclusions:

    • The interaction between selenium compounds and Cd2+ is dependent on selenium's oxidation state and chemical form.
    • Selenite and selenourea interactions with Cd2+ suggest potential mechanisms influencing cadmium bioavailability and toxicity.
    • These findings contribute to understanding cadmium toxicity and the in vivo effects of selenium supplementation on metal ion distribution.
